The approved projects total 1,975MWac, the largest capacity granted since the LSS programme began in 2016. Malaysia’s large-scale solar scheme (LSS) has approved 6,028 MW of solar capacity to 117 companies across six bidding rounds to date, according to the country’s Ministry of Energy Transition and Water Transformation. More than 6 GW of utility-scale solar projects have been approved under Malaysia’s. Malaysia’s Energy Commission on Monday launched another bidding under its Large Scale Solar (LSS) programme, offering 2 GW more for ground-mounted and floating solar capacities. Interested parties have a February 28 deadline to submit Request for Proposal (RfP) documents for two packages -- one. Analysts noted that this marks the largest rollout of LSS projects in the nation’s history, keeping solar players occupied with engineering, procurement, construction, and commissioning (EPCC) works through 2027.

Solar power containers combine solar photovoltaic (PV) systems, battery storage, inverters, and auxiliary components into a self-contained shipping container. By integrating all necessary equipment within a transportable structure, these units provide modular, plug-and-play renewable energy systems.
